Product Description
GPS RADIONOVA M10372 is a highly integrated
GPS RF Antenna Module suitable for L1-band GPS
and A-GPS systems. The device is based on the high
performance SiRFstarIV GPS architecture combined
with Antenovas high efciency antenna technology
designed to provide an optimal radiation pattern for
GPS reception.
All RF front-end and baseband components are
contained in a single package laminate base module
providing a complete GPS receiver for optimum
performance. M10372 operates on a single 1.8V
positive bias supply with low power consumption andavailable low power modes for further power savings.
M10372 is a complete GPS system solution with a
stand-alone GPS engine that can generate a PVT
solution without relying upon host-device processing
power and is compatible with UART, SPI and I2C host
processor interfaces.
Custom versions of the M10372 can also incorporate
an antenna switch for optional active antenna
connection. Custom versions are subject to minimum
order quantities.

Recommended Application Schematic for M10372-A1 without
external antenna support
The following schematic shows the recommended connection for the module (without external antenna
support) for stand alone applications. Please contact Antenova for A-GPS applications.
L1-4 and C1,2,3 and 5 are LC lters to prevent in-band GPS noise being conducted into the module. In the event that CTS and RTS are
also connected to the host processor, then similar lters should be used on these lines. Filter components should be placed as close to
the M10372 connector as possible.
A large capacitor should also be included on the VCC line in order to keep the input voltage ripple to a minimum. R1 and R2 are hardware
straps to set the host port conguration on startup.

Recommended Circuit Schematic for M10372-A1X modules to
Support External Antenna
To support an external antenna the module includes an on board RF switch. The host device can control this
switch via the Pin 22 voltage (Vcnt). When this pin is high, the RF switch disconnects the embedded internal
antenna, and routes the signal from pin 28 to the RF front end. In order to provide this control voltage, acurrent detector circuit is suggested. Optional over-voltage protection can also be provided, to protect the
power supply in the event of a short circuit in the antenna connection.
A suggestion for such a circuit is given in the gure below:
U1 and Q1 provide a current sense function, amplifying the voltage drop across sense resistor R1. Thiscurrent sense voltage is used to control the output of the window comparator U2. When the current through
the antenna bias circuit is between 5 and 50mA, then the comparator asserts high, and the RF switch selects
the external antenna. Outside of this range, the comparator detects either a DC short or open circuit in the
bias circuit and asserts low, selecting the internal antenna.
Additionally, the current sense voltage is fed to the gate of Q2, increasing the resistance in the bias circuit as
the voltage rises, and choking off the antenna supply current when it rises above 100mA.

Module Communication - UART
The default UART communication setting for the M10372 is NMEA-0183 protocol at 4800 Baud, 8 data bits, 1
stop bit, no ow control. After boot-up, the host can select a different data rate from 1200 baud up to 1.8432
Mbaud. There is also the option to use hardware ow control.
